Intel

Xeon W-2195

The Xeon W-2195 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 29 September 2017 (8 years ago). It is based on the Skylake (server) (2017−2018) architecture. It features 18 cores and 36 threads. Base frequency is 2.3 GHz, with boost up to 4.3 GHz. L3 cache: 24.75 MB (total). L2 cache: 1 MB (per core). Built on 14 nm process technology. Socket: LGA2011. Thermal design power (TDP): 140 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-1600, DDR4-1866, DDR4-2133, DDR4-2400, DDR4-2666. Passmark benchmark score: 27,977 points. Launch price was $2,553.

AMD

Ryzen 9 7950X3D

The Ryzen 9 7950X3D is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 4 January 2023 (2 years ago). It is based on the Raphael (Zen4) (2022−2023) architecture. It features 16 cores and 32 threads. Base frequency is 4.2 GHz, with boost up to 5.7 GHz. L3 cache: 128 MB (total). L2 cache: 1 MB (per core). Built on 5 nm, 6 nm process technology. Socket: AM5. Thermal design power (TDP): 120 Watt. Memory support: DDR5-5200. Passmark benchmark score: 62,323 points. Launch price was $699.

Processing Power

The Xeon W-2195 packs 18 cores / 36 threads, while the Ryzen 9 7950X3D offers 16 cores / 32 threads — the Xeon W-2195 has 2 more cores. Boost clocks reach 4.3 GHz on the Xeon W-2195 versus 5.7 GHz on the Ryzen 9 7950X3D — a 28% clock advantage for the Ryzen 9 7950X3D (base: 2.3 GHz vs 4.2 GHz). The Xeon W-2195 uses the Skylake (server) (2017−2018) architecture (14 nm), while the Ryzen 9 7950X3D uses Raphael (Zen4) (2022−2023) (5 nm, 6 nm). In PassMark, the Xeon W-2195 scores 27,977 against the Ryzen 9 7950X3D's 62,323 — a 76.1% lead for the Ryzen 9 7950X3D. Cinebench R23 multi-core: 21,000 vs 38,581 (59% advantage for the Ryzen 9 7950X3D). Geekbench 6 single-core — the metric most relevant to gaming — records 1,300 vs 2,926, a 77% lead for the Ryzen 9 7950X3D that directly translates to higher frame rates. Multi-core Geekbench: 10,002 vs 19,643 (65% advantage for the Ryzen 9 7950X3D). L3 cache: 24.75 MB (total) on the Xeon W-2195 vs 128 MB (total) on the Ryzen 9 7950X3D.

Memory & Platform

The Xeon W-2195 uses the LGA2011 socket (PCIe 3.0), while the Ryzen 9 7950X3D uses AM5 (PCIe 5.0) — making them incompatible on the same motherboard. Maximum memory speed reaches DDR4-2666 on the Xeon W-2195 versus DDR5-5200 on the Ryzen 9 7950X3D — the Ryzen 9 7950X3D supports 22.2% faster memory, which can translate to measurable gains in memory-sensitive workloads. The Xeon W-2195 supports up to 512 GB of RAM compared to 128 GB 120% more capacity for professional workloads. Memory channels: 4 (Xeon W-2195) vs 2 (Ryzen 9 7950X3D). PCIe lanes: 48 (Xeon W-2195) vs 28 (Ryzen 9 7950X3D) — the Xeon W-2195 offers 20 more lanes for additional GPUs or NVMe drives. Chipset compatibility: C422 (Xeon W-2195) and AMD X670E,AMD X670,AMD B650E,AMD B650 (Ryzen 9 7950X3D).
